Side-by-side financial comparison of KORN FERRY (KFY) and Roblox Corp (RBLX). Click either name above to swap in a different company.

Roblox Corp is the larger business by last-quarter revenue ($1.4B vs $729.8M, roughly 1.9× KORN FERRY). KORN FERRY runs the higher net margin — 9.9% vs -22.3%, a 32.3% gap on every dollar of revenue. On growth, Roblox Corp posted the faster year-over-year revenue change (43.2% vs 7.0%). Roblox Corp produced more free cash flow last quarter ($308.6M vs $100.7M). Over the past eight quarters, Roblox Corp's revenue compounded faster (32.9% CAGR vs 3.8%).

Korn Ferry is a management consulting firm headquartered in Los Angeles, California. It was founded in 1969 and as of 2019, operates in 111 offices in 53 countries and employs 8,198 people worldwide. Korn Ferry operates through four business segments: Consulting, Digital, Executive Search, Recruitment Process Outsourcing and Professional Search.

Roblox Corporation is an American video game developer based in San Mateo, California. Founded in 2004 by David Baszucki and Erik Cassel, the company is the developer of Roblox, a game platform, which was released in 2006. As of December 31, 2024, the company employs over 2,400 people.
